How to Deposit Crypto at Lucky Anon

Depositing crypto at Lucky Anon takes about a minute. This guide covers the supported cryptocurrencies, the deposit-address flow, what to expect for confirmation times, and how to troubleshoot a deposit that hasn't shown up.

Quick Answer

Sign in, open the Wallet, choose your cryptocurrency, copy the deposit address shown on screen, and send funds from your exchange or personal wallet. Your balance updates automatically after the network confirms the transaction — typically seconds to a few minutes depending on the chain. Lucky Anon accepts Bitcoin, USDT, USDC, Ethereum, Solana, Ripple, Binance Coin, Tron, Litecoin, and Dogecoin.

Supported Cryptocurrencies

Lucky Anon supports the major chains used for casino deposits. Pick whichever you already hold — there's no advantage to using one over another beyond the network fee you'd pay on your sending side.

Stablecoins

USDT and USDC keep your balance pegged to USD so you're not exposed to price swings between depositing and playing.

Bitcoin & Litecoin

BTC and LTC are the OG deposit currencies — universally available on every exchange, with mature wallet support.

Fast Chains

Solana (SOL), Ripple (XRP), and Tron (TRX) confirm in seconds with tiny fees. Best when you want the lowest friction from send to play.

Ethereum, BNB & Dogecoin

ETH, BNB, and DOGE are also supported. Ethereum gas fees can be higher than other chains, so factor that into your send.

Step-by-Step Deposit Flow

The full flow takes under a minute on your end. Most of the time is just waiting for the network to confirm.

1

Sign Up or Sign In

Click Sign Up and enter an email — no KYC, no documents, no waiting period. Existing users just sign in.

2

Open the Wallet

Tap the Wallet button. The deposit panel lists every supported cryptocurrency with its symbol and network.

3

Pick Your Coin and Copy the Address

Select the cryptocurrency you want to deposit. A unique deposit address is generated for your account. Copy it — or scan the QR code from your mobile wallet app.

4

Send From Your Wallet or Exchange

Open your exchange (Coinbase, Binance, Kraken, etc.) or self-custody wallet and send the chosen amount to the copied address. Double-check the network matches before sending — sending USDT on the wrong chain is the most common mistake.

5

Wait for Confirmation

Your balance updates automatically once the network confirms the transaction. Solana and XRP confirm in seconds; Bitcoin typically needs 1–3 confirmations and may take 10–30 minutes.

Avoid the Common Deposit Mistakes

Nearly every delayed or lost deposit traces back to one of these. Read them before you send.

Pro Tips

  • Match the network exactly — USDT exists on Ethereum (ERC-20), Tron (TRC-20), and Solana. Send on the wrong network and recovery is difficult.
  • Copy the address fresh each time. Some wallets cache an old address; pasting last week's address could route funds to a different account.
  • Send a small test amount first if you're depositing a large sum. The $1 trial fee is cheaper than misplacing $10,000.
  • Stablecoins (USDT, USDC) avoid price volatility. If you're depositing for a session and don't want exposure to BTC moves, use a stablecoin.
  • Network fees come from your sending wallet, not Lucky Anon. Exchange withdrawals sometimes add a flat fee — check your exchange's withdrawal page before confirming.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does a crypto deposit take to show up?

Depends on the chain. Solana, XRP, and Tron confirm in seconds. Litecoin and BNB usually arrive in under a minute. Bitcoin typically requires 1–3 network confirmations and lands within 10–30 minutes. Ethereum varies with network congestion.

Is there a minimum deposit?

There's no hard minimum on the wallet itself, but if you want to claim the welcome bonus, each of the four bonus-eligible deposits must be at least $20 in equivalent value.

My deposit hasn't shown up — what should I do?

First, verify the transaction on the blockchain explorer for that chain (using the transaction hash from your sending wallet). If it shows confirmed but your balance hasn't updated, contact support with the txid — they can credit the deposit manually.

Does Lucky Anon charge a deposit fee?

No. Lucky Anon doesn't charge a fee on deposits. The only cost is the network fee on your sending side, which is paid to miners or validators of the chain you're using.
